If tan θ = ¾, then Sin θ is:

OpenStudy (anonymous):

tan = opposite / adjacent sin = opposite / hypotenuse u have 2 draw a triangle... right angled... use Pythagoras theorem to solve for the unknown side ***************************************************************************

OpenStudy (wolf1728):

If tangent of theta = 3/4 then theta = arctangent of 3/4 or 36.87 Degrees. So the sine of theta = sine 36.87 Degrees = .6

OpenStudy (souvik):

or u can do like this.. \[\sin^2 \theta =1-\cos^2 \theta=1-\frac{ 1 }{ \sec^2 \theta }=1-\frac{ 1 }{ 1+ \tan^2 \theta }\] then square root it
